JOPLIN, Mo. — The bats got loose once again for Griffon Baseball, going off for 14 hits in a 13-8 win over McKendree on Saturday at Warren Turner Field in day two of the MIAA/GLVC Crossover.
Missouri Western (3-2) wasted no time, putting up four runs in the bottom of the first inning. McKendree (0-5) made it a one-run game in the sixth at 4-3, but a
Cale Sackewitz RBI single to right field just a frame later started yet another run for MWSU.
Jackson Bryant took home an RBI after being hit by a pitch with the bases loaded, setting up a
Brenden Andersen single that brought home two runs after after a McKendree error, scoring Jhontan Pena and Sackewitz.
After a six-run sixth inning and two more in the seventh,
Hunter Rumachik capped MWSU's scoring with a solo shot to left field, putting Missouri Western up, 13-4. McKendree did score four runs in the top of the ninth, but pitcher
Jared Wells weathered the storm and stopped the Bearcats' late comeback attempt.
NOTABLES
- Rumachik's home run is the first of the season for MWSU.
- Andersen finished with a game-high three RBI.
- Will Courtney went 2-for-4 at the plate with a double and two RBI.
- Hunter Olson had a monster day at the dish, going 4-of-5 with three doubles, two RBI and a run scored.
- Jacob Weirich picked up his first win of the season with six innings tossed and five strikeouts.
